Both of these have a gorgeous glossy formula so it is a change from the matte lip that I am used to. I chose a lovely nude-ish pink colour called Kittenish and a bright red-pink colour called Pleasant...


Kittenish is what I would say to be one of the most perfect nude and wearable colours. It is a great pink shade to wear during both the daytime and nighttime. With one application it looks natural whereas it can be layered up for a bolder light pink colour. I like to use this on top of MAC Soar lip liner in the evening. Even though it is a slightly different colour, I think the combination of the two are just perfect. The size of this product is also amazing for a makeup bag or for a clutch bag on a night out. I think this shade is great for all skin tones. So if you are looking for a new pinky nude shade, I would definitely recommend this.

Pleasant is the most gorgeous bright pink shade. It isn't too dark or too red which, for me and my skin tone, makes it perfect, especially for the summer. The only small problem I have with this is that it is very very glossy. I am used to having more matte and satin shades for a dark lip, but nevertheless I am prepared to work through it. I like to use this colour to brighten up my makeup look, especially during the day with minimal eyeshadow. Once again this is a great staple to have in your makeup bag or clutch bag on a night out. Kiko Long Lasting Stick Eyeshadows in shades 25 and 38
These eyeshadow sticks are out of this world in my opinion. They are so highly pigmented its amazing. I have wanted to try the By Terry Ombre Blackstar eyeshadow sticks for ages but because of the price I was a bit sceptical. Trying the Kiko ones as an alternative was a great idea. In the sale, they were only £3.40 each, which I believe to be a steal. Shade 25 is a great colour for all over the lid if you want a subtle look. It is also a great base shade and a brightening shade for in the corner of the eye. Shade 38 is great for all over the lid for an evening and dramatic look. It is also a great colour for in the crease. These shades are all great for their blending abilities. However, if you leave them too long, then they set, so you better get the blending brush out fast! These eyeshadow sticks have staying power, as the name of them suggests. To take them off, a good eye makeup remover is needed, especially one that removes waterproof makeup. I use Benefit's They're Real Remover and it works a treat.

MAC Lipsticks in Chatterbox and Vegas Volt
I love lipsticks as many of you know, especially MAC ones. My collection increases each time I go into a MAC store. These are definitely two of my most used ones and think that they are just so perfect for the summer. They both have an Amplified finished, meaning the pigmentation is amazing but they are so nourishing for the lips, so there is no dryness like I get from the Retro Matte finishes. Chatterbox is the most beautiful bright but not so bright pink shade. I bought it for my May Ball event for my sixth form last year. It goes well with every single makeup look and can easily be dulled down to be a nude with a smokey eye or to be a bold statement lip. Vegas Volt is one of the only orange shades that MAC do that suits my skin tone. I bought this at the same time I got Nars Laguna last year and think they are great together to form a bronzey summer look. As these lipsticks are both so nourishing for the lips, it helps keep them hydrated, even in the heat of the summer. If you want to start experimenting with bold lips, I think the Amplified finished is the best and these colours are a great transition.
